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
08002000047 85487773394 92338667704 219
251749 6216590010
251749 6216590010
4911369740 36054336 63905
All about undefined
Interested in learning more?
251749 6216590010
4911369740 36054336 63905
See more
5969 072626
717567 5841 6963764507 507682
See more
18269 4404
2026 7949130 87 589
See more